Software Engineers are the core of our Engineering team at Pusher, working across the stack to deliver awesome products at massive scale.
Pusher
Pusher is a communication layer for application developers that routes data at scale and in realtime.
The current core Pusher product is a multi-tenant distributed system that allows our customers to deliver tens of billions of messages to their connected users. We operate at mind-boggling scale, and this informs and affects everything we do.
We want to improve the lives of other developers by solving hard problems for them, and by freeing them from operating and maintaining their own infrastructure. We’re passionate about developer experience and making our APIs as easy to use as we can.
What you will be doing
Pusher is a challenging but supportive environment. We are still small enough to be a team of generalist engineers with individual specialisms, so we want you to get involved with as much of our engineering lifecycle as possible. Your typical week might involve the following...
Read more here: https://pusher.workable.com/jobs/346844